
Dr. Lucette Adet shares her journey and research on tree species in the Congo Basin amidst climate change.
Growing up excited for every visit to her grandparents’ farm where she could sit amongst the trees eating tropical fruits, Dr. Lucette Adet has always been fascinated by plants. Currently undertaking research in the Congo Basin in Cameroon, Lucette aims to understand how different tree species respond to their environment, in the context of changes in climate and land-use.
